WebThe Ideal Regenerative Reheat Cycle using both an Open and a Closed Feedwater Heater In a practical power plant one may find various combinations of closed and open feedwater heaters. For example the Gavin Power Plant has one open- and 7 closed-feedwater heaters in each of the two sections of the plant (refer to the Case Study at the end of this section). WebMay 22, 2024 · To calculate the thermal efficiency of the simplest Rankine cycle (without reheating) engineers use the first law of thermodynamics in terms of enthalpy rather than in terms of internal energy. The first law in terms of enthalpy is: dH = dQ + Vdp. In this equation the term Vdp is a flow process work.
